Hello to both of you,  I agree with you Jamie,  It looks like a neat little bottle but the glass working skill is not there.  The handle is not right, the older glass makers knew how to pull the glass rod to a smaller diameter and apply the handle in a different method on this size bottle.  The glass doesn't look right either, they obviously didn't care, or thought the crappy glass looked older.  Sorry, but it just isn't right.  RED Matthews
